Contains a source of Amylase to hydrolyze starch, Protease for hydrolyzing proteins, Cellulase for breaking down cellulose, Hemicellulase for breaking down Hemicellulose, and a source of live (viable) naturally occuring microorganisms, for non-lactating dairy cattle and dry or lactating cows.
On-Farm Mixing
Select BioCycle®

Use Directions
Mix Select BioCycle® into manufactured dairy feeds at the rate of 0.25 oz (7 g) per head beef or non-lactating dairy cattle or 0.50 oz (14 g) per head dry or lactating dairy cattle per day with grain, forage, or TMR.
Fungal amylase (A. oryzae) 7,000 SKB/g
Fungal protease (A. oryzae) 5,000 HUT/g
Lipase (Candida cylindracea) 500 FIP/g
Cellulase (T. reesei) 5,000 CU/g
Pectinase (A. niger) 100 ENDO-PG/g
Bacillus subtilis (min) 50 x 106cfu/g
Ingredients
Calcium Carbonate, Yeast Culture, Montmorillonite Clay, Potassium iodide, Silicon Dioxide, Dried egg product, Saccharomyces cerevisiae (Active dry yeast), Dried Aspergillus oryzae Fermentation Extract, Dried Bacillus subtilis Fermentation Product, Sugars, Lactic Acid, Citric Acid, Acetic Acid, Benzoic Acid.
Packaging & Storage
Available in 50lb. boxes. Store in a cool, dry place to maintain its efficacy for up to two years.

A New Approach To Direct-Fed Microbials
BioCycle® is recommended when performance improvements are needed in reproduction and overall herd health. Select BioCycle® is not appropriate when mold-challenged feeds are the major problem.
One of the key factors making Select BioCycle® more effective is the presence of L-form bacteria. The L-form bacteria found in the BioCycle® line are unequaled among DFM products. Stripped of their cell walls, they are much more active than their less-developed relatives. Because they are dormant until consumed, L-form bacteria have an excellent shelf life and survive when mixed with high mineral feed ingredients, allowing them to reach the lower digestive system unharmed.
BioCycle® contains two separate L-form bacteria, enhancing the function and population of the microflora in the lower gut. BioCycle® also contains both yeast culture and live cell yeast that produce a broad range of metabolites including B-vitamins, a broad-based enzyme package to enhance nutrient digestions, specialized proteins for the unexpected challenges, microbial sugars for nourishment of other gut microbes, and potassium iodide to enhance metabolism.
